Type 2 Diabetes doesn’t develop in a day. It starts much early as Pre Diabetes, where ,Fasting blood glucose is between 100-125 mg/dl called as Impaired Fasting Glucose(IFG) and/or 2 hours post prandial blood glucose 140-199 mg/dl called as Impaired Glucose Tolerance (IGT). Both IGT & IFG are being classified as Pre Diabetes. So, T2DM develops after a period of 3-7 years of pre diabetes in India. This is a golden opportunity in the life of a person with T2DM, that if they follow consistent structured Life Style Modification (LSM), at least 50% of these people with pre diabetes can become normal, remaining 50% either will remain Pre Diabetes or will become T2DM in next 5-10 yrs. Thus, screening and early detection of Pre Diabetes can play a vital role in prevention of T2DM.
